Overview

package devf provides livereload webserver for developers (inspired by devd). It attempts to do one thing and do it well: serve as a reverse proxy while injecting some JS to support livereloading.

The livereload is triggered by a std-input newline or some OS-signals (usually provided by another tool).

Usage:

devf [options] http-url-or-local-folder

If `http-url-or-local-folder` contains `://`, it will be interpreted as a URL, otherwise as a local folder.

The flags are:

-addr string
	address to listen to (default ":8080")
-sig value
	comma-separated list of signals which will trigger a reload
	(instead of stdin newline): abrt,hup,int,kill,pipe,quit,term,usr1,usr2

Example using inotifywait on linux

inotifywait -m -e close_write **/*.go | \
	xargs -n1 -d "\n" vanitydoc -html=dist/devf gitea://codeberg.org/pfad.fr/devf | \
	devf dist

Explanation:

  • on any change to a go file (using inotifywait),
  • re-generates the package documentation (using xargs and vanitydoc),
  • serve the content of `dist` and automatically reloads the webbrowser using devf

Example using modd

**/*.gohtml server.is_running {
    daemon: devf -sig hup http://localhost:8989
}

modd will send a sighup to devf (which will trigger a reload) whenever a .gohtml file changes or the `server.is_running` file is written to (I usually do that in my main.go, when the server is ready to accept connections).

To ensure that the livereload is injected on pages (especially error pages), make sure that they have the `Content-Type` header starts with `text/html`.

Advanced usage

If you need more control regarding the triggering of the reload, the reverse-proxying or of the local server, take a look at the livereload subpackage.
